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services Enrollments API

Enrollment grouping validation and information.

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services Enrollments API is one of 41 APIs that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services publishes on the APIs.io network, described by a machine-readable OpenAPI specification.

Tagged areas include Enrollments. The published artifact set on APIs.io includes an OpenAPI specification, API documentation, authentication docs, and a GitHub repository.

This API exposes 1 operation across 1 path, and defines 12 schemas. It is described by OpenAPI 3.2.0, at version 1.

Requests are made against a single base URL, https://marketplace.api.healthcare.gov/api/v1.

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services Enrollments API declares 1 security scheme for authenticating requests. An API key is passed in the query as apikey (API_Key). By default, every request must be authenticated.

  • API_Key — Your API key should be included as a query parameter with the request. You can [fill out this form](https://cms.gov1.qualtrics.com/jfe/form/SV4N2GHCJfNuX7n8x)…

Across 1 path, the API surfaces 1 operation — 1 POST. Each is listed below with its method, path, parameters, and response codes.

Enrollments 1

Enrollment grouping validation and information.

POST
/enrollment/validate
Verify extended enrollment groups. The endpoint assumes an effective date of Jan 1 on enrollees ages unless effectiveage is provided on the enrollees. If iscustom is true, the endpoint will validate…
